#479400 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#479400 is composed of 27.8% red, 58%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 91.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 29%. #479400 color hex could be obtained by blending #8eff00 with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#479400 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#479400 has RGB values of R:71, G:148,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:1,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 4690944.

Hex triplet 479400 #479400
RGB Decimal 71, 148, 0 rgb(71,148,0)
RGB Percent 27.8, 58, 0 rgb(27.8%,58%,0%)
CMYK 52, 0, 100, 42
HSL 91.2°, 100, 29 hsl(91.2,100%,29%)
HSV (or HSB) 91.2°, 100, 58
Web Safe 339900 #339900
CIE-LAB 54.573, -45.342, 57.181
XYZ 13.188, 22.519, 3.652
xyY 0.335, 0.572, 22.519
CIE-LCH 54.573, 72.977, 128.413
CIE-LUV 54.573, -36.951, 65.013
Hunter-Lab 47.454, -33.437, 28.655
Binary 01000111, 10010100, 00000000

Shades and Tints of #479400

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050b00 is the darkest color, while #fafff6 is the lightest one.
